If P216 or P416 color formats are selected with AMF, these color formats
were not explicitly handled, so the switch statements would end up in
the default case. If the user had also selected a Rec. 2100 color space,
this would result in the strange error message:
"OBS does not support 8-bit output of Rec. 2100."
This message is confusing and does not correctly reflect the chosen
settings. Let's explicitly handle the P216/P416 cases and provide a more
accurate error message.
If P216 or P416 color formats are selected with NVENC, OBS will fall
back from the native implementation to the FFmpeg implementation. Here,
P216 and P416 were not explicitly handled, so the switch statements
would end up in the default case. If the user had also selected a Rec.
2100 color space, this would result in the strange error message:
"OBS does not support 8-bit output of Rec. 2100."
This message is confusing and does not correctly reflect the chosen
settings. Let's explicitly handle the P216/P416 cases and provide a more
accurate error message.
Fixes an issue where update/destroy of a media source during reconnect
would block the parent thread until the next reconnect attempt. This
would result in significant quantities of dropped frames, delayed OBS
shutdown, or frozen UI during this period.
In avcodec.h, the docs for AVCodecContext->framerate say:
encoding: May be used to signal the framerate of CFR content to an
encoder.
OBS is designed to always output Constant Frame Rate (CFR) content.
Instead of letting this be implied, let's explicitly set the framerate
per the docs.
When using FFmpeg-based NVENC, with b-frames, and a non-1 framerate
numerator (eg. `1001/60000` aka 59.94fps), the DTS values outputted
by FFmpeg result in invalid DTS values.
Detect when using an unpatched FFmpeg build and correct the values
accordingly.

With 5fe417bce1 it became possible to use
Opus in local recordings, this could potentially have the user try to
record Opus in MP4.
FLAC in MP4 was marked as stable in FFmpeg 6.0
Opus in MP4 was marked as stable in FFmpeg 4.3
For Ubuntu 20.04 we still need the latter, for 22.04 (and potentially
other Linux distributions) the former.
While FLAC is not yet implemented, we may want to do that in the near
future so for simplicity just keep it at 6.0.

FFmpeg has reverted their default AAC encoder from fast to twoloop,
which has much better rate control management, making it closer to CBR,
and it sounds much better.

Stingers -- and especially track matte stingers -- are currently subject
to real time decoding, which can be detrimental in a production
environment where a stinger video may not be able to decode in a timely
fashion.
To remedy this, this change adds an option to fully decode stingers
immediately and cache the decoded video/audio in RAM for playback to
greatly improve stinger performance.
When bitrate is updated, a check against 'lookahead' setting is done.
If 'lookahead' is enabled, the bitrate update is disabled.
We indeed used to observe crashes with nvenc when frequent bitrate
resettings were effected while lookahead option was enabled.
But recent tests have shown that the issue is gone.
As a result this commit allows 'lookahead' with bitrate live update.
